DEPARTMENT OF JUSTICE
Drug Enforcement Administration
Manufacturer of Controlled Substances; Notice of Registration
By Notice dated January 23, 2007, and published in the Federal Register on
January 30, 2007, (72 FR 4296), American Radiolabeled Chemical, Inc., 101 Arc
Drive, St. Louis, Missouri 63146, made application by letter to the Drug
Enforcement Administration (DEA) to be registered as a bulk manufacturer of the
basic classes of controlled substances listed in schedule I and II:

The company plans to manufacture small quantities of the listed controlled
substances as radiolabeled compounds for biochemical research.
No comments or objections have been received. DEA has considered the factors
in 21 U.S.C. 823(a) and determined that the registration of American
Radiolabeled Chemical, Inc. to manufacture the listed basic class of controlled
substance is consistent with the public interest at this time. DEA has
investigated American Radiolabeled Chemical, Inc. to ensure that the company's
registration is consistent with the public interest. The investigation has
included inspection and testing of the company's physical security systems,
verification of the company's compliance with State and local laws, and a review
of the company's background and history. Therefore, pursuant to 21 U.S.C. 823,
and in accordance with 21 CFR
1301.33, the above named company is granted
registration as a bulk manufacturer of the basic classes of controlled
substances listed.
